Job summary

Sorren, Inc. in California is seeking a skilled accounting professional to perform and supervise complex accounting tasks across multiple entities, including reconciliations, journal entries, and bill payments. CPA-eligible candidates are preferred, with a strong GAAP foundation and multi-entity experience.

This full-time role requires 3-5 years of general accounting, excellent communication, and the ability to coach junior staff while meeting deadlines and year-end objectives.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ting or related field is required.
  • CPA license or eligibility preferred.
  • Strong GAAP knowledge and financial reporting experience.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
  • Ability to work independently and coach junior staff.
  • Experience with multi-entity accounting and month-end close.

Responsibilities

  • Perform, supervise, and review complex accounting tasks, including reconciliations, journal entries, coding expenses, bill payments, and accounts receivable for multiple entities.
  • Oversee annual accounting procedures to prepare records for tax preparation, 1099s, and tangible personal property returns.
  • Prepare and review compilations on a monthly, quarterly, or annual basis based on client requirements.
  • Identify material misstatements and evaluate inconsistencies in financial reports.
  • Prepare client cash flow forecasts and monitor engagement performance against budgets.
  • Analyze organizational structures and financial impacts to ensure accurate accounting.
  • Train and review work for associates, providing constructive feedback to foster growth.
  • Communicate effectively with team members and clients to address project statuses and inquiries.
  • Contribute to team efforts through collaboration, volunteering support, and knowledge sharing.
  • Participate in professional development through training sessions and independent learning.
  • Manage multiple engagements and prioritize tasks to meet deadlines.
  • Perform other duties and display flexibility to take on a variety of responsibilities assigned by firm leadership.
  • Meet annual billable hour and other targets to fulfill individual performance and overall firm productivity.
